2013-08-22 11 views

Odpowiedz

52

Forever dokumentacja explains each briefly:

--minUptime  Minimum uptime (millis) for a script to not be considered "spinning" 
--spinSleepTime Time to wait (millis) between launches of a spinning script. 

A "przędzenie" wniosek jest jeden, który utrzymuje braku/awarii wkrótce po ponownym uruchomieniu.

--minUptime określa minimalny czas działania aplikacji. Jeśli ulegnie awarii przed tym limitem, zostanie uznany za "spinning" lub problematyczny.

--spinSleepTime ustawia ilość czasu, forever będzie czekać przed ponowną próbą ponownego uruchomienia „przędzenie” aplikacji.

Łącznie pomagają zapobiec ponownemu uruchomieniu aplikacji tylko po to, aby się zawiesić.

+0

Dziękuję, to jest pomocne :) –

+4

Czy istnieje sposób, aby w ogóle uniemożliwić ponowne uruchomienie aplikacji i/lub zgłosić, że zbyt długo się zawieszał? Istnieje opcja '-m', ale nie rozróżnia ona wirujących awarii i awarii po prawidłowym uruchomieniu aplikacji. –

+0

Czy istnieje sposób na poddanie się po tak wielu próbach zakręcenia? – occasl